Windows

运行 EPM Automate 之前,确保您可以从运行 EPM Automate 的计算机中访问您的环境。

EPM Automate 会在当前目录中创建一个 .prefs 文件(其中包含用户信息)和日志文件。在 Windows 计算机上,.prefs 文件的内容仅对创建它的用户以及 Windows 管理员可见。在 Linux、UNIX 和 macOSX 环境中,.prefs 文件使用权限 600 生成,该权限仅允许所有者对此文件进行读取和写入。

如果您对执行 EPM Automate 的 Windows 目录没有写入权限,则 EPM Automate 将在 Windows 环境中显示 FileNotFoundException: .prefs (Access is denied) 错误。要解决此错误,请确保当前用户的 Windows 帐户对从中运行 EPM Automate 的目录具有读/写访问权限。此外,该用户还必须对从中访问(例如,在运行 uploadFile 命令时)或写入(例如,在运行 downloadFile 命令)文件的任何其他目录具有适当的访问权限。

注:

不能从名称中包含 & 的文件夹运行 EPM Automate;例如 C:\Oracle\A&B

要在 Windows 客户端上运行 EPM Automate

  1. 依次单击开始所有程序EPM Automate启动 EPM Automate。此时将显示 EPM Automate 命令提示符。
  2. 可选:导航到您要在其中使用 EPM Automate 执行操作的目录。
  3. 可选:生成密码加密文件。您可使用密码加密文件传递加密密码,以启动会话。
    epmautomate encrypt P@ssword1 myKey C:/mySecuredir/password.epw
  4. 服务管理员身份启动一个会话。使用类似下面的命令:
    • 使用未加密密码:

      epmautomate login serviceAdmin P@ssword1 
      https://test-cloudpln.pbcs_us1.oraclecloud.com
    • 使用加密密码:

      epmautomate login serviceAdmin C:\mySecuredir\password.epw 
      https://test-cloudpln.pbcs_us1.oraclecloud.com
  5. 输入命令以执行您要完成的任务。

    有关命令执行状态的信息,请参阅“退出代码”。

  6. 从环境中注销。使用以下命令:
    epmautomate logout